The Kent State University Press, 2011 Ray Bradbury's first stories, in their original format (Bradbury was a perfectionist, so it was not uncommon for him to rewrite a story for later collections). Included is an appendix with notes regarding each story, as well as a summary of his unpublished stories. An excellent addition to the library of any fan, and a great resource for literary scholars.
